Hydrocarbons involve constant movement between molecular structures, reaction conditions, and products. A diagram-based resource can make these connections easier to revisit and apply.
Use the diagrams to quickly revisit important hydrocarbon structures instead of repeatedly drawing them from your notes during every revision cycle.
Reaction schemes can help you follow how one hydrocarbon changes into another and identify the structural change taking place between the starting compound and product.
Having structural representations available can help you distinguish between compounds that differ only in bonding, chain arrangement, or other structural features.
Cover the product or final part of a reaction representation and try to predict it yourself. This turns the diagrams into a quick self-testing activity rather than passive reading.
Regular exposure to structural representations can help you read molecular formulas and reaction schemes more carefully, reducing mistakes when a JEE question depends on identifying a particular structural feature.
